CrP2O6 is a chromium phosphate ceramic compound belonging to the polyphosphate family of materials. While not widely established in mainstream engineering, chromium phosphates are investigated primarily in research contexts for their potential in high-temperature applications, corrosion-resistant coatings, and specialized chemical processing environments. This compound represents an emerging material class where phosphate chemistry combines with chromium's oxidation resistance to create compositions of interest for extreme-condition applications where conventional ceramics may be limited.
